Letters to the Editor: Catholic sex education won't help children flourish


This programme, developed by the Catholic Bishops Conference, alignsa central part of the wellbeing programme for our children with a Catholic ethos. The conflating of a religious programme with relationships and sexuality education. It is a programme that is designed to further the teachings of the Catholic Church. The failure to align the teaching of RSE in primary and secondary schools. ‘Flourish’ will result in a disconnect between a religious approach taken in the 90% of primary schools under Catholic management and the non religious approach taken by secondary schools to RSE.
